CO2 GRO Inc (TSX-V:GROW, OTCQB:BLONF) and its Mexican sales partner have announced that a second technology trial using the former's technology is going ahead in the North American country.
The company and Rancho Nexo said the trial is at an anonymous customer's 5,500 square feet (sq ft) bell pepper greenhouse in the state of Querétaro.
The aim is to increase fruit yield, reduce the spread of pathogens such as powdery mildew, and reduce the overall cost per unit of production and lift margins.
"Commercial success at these two Mexican vegetable Trials with our partner Rancho Nexo should open the door to many other Mexican AMHPAC member vegetable growers trying our technology," said CO2 GRO's VP sales and strategic alliances Aaron Archibald in a statement.
"They represent 90% of Mexico's vegetable exports to the US and Canada."

On April 7 this year, CO2 GRO and Rancho Nexo announced the first Trial in Mexico for Bresca Hortalizas S.P.R. de R.L. in the latter's new greenhouse in the State of Puebla.
"Rancho Nexo is committed to bringing key technologies to Mexican Agri Business of which CO2 GRO's precision ag technology is integral," said Rancho Nexo's Matt Grant.
The company's technology creates a dissolved CO2 solution that is misted onto plants grown in greenhouses and protected grower facilities globally, providing growers with multiple significant benefits.
The firm says growers that cannot atmospherically enrich their facilities with CO2 (gassing) can now realize yield increases of up to 30% and up to a doubling of gross profits while suppressing the development of micro-pathogens such as E.coli and powdery mildew.
Greenhouses and indoor facilities that currently do employ CO2 gassing can save up to 90% on their CO2 consumption, thereby reducing their production costs and CO2 enrichment emissions.
